according to rock sound magazine.

so my friend has a subscription to rocksound magazine, and she just got the new copy of it. she's a tool fan, and she new i'd be as interested as she was about this article they've written about them. it's like a two page spread with a massive photo of maynard and justin, with a small piece of writing. The article claims the title to be "ten thousand days", but also three of the albums track titles to be "ten thousand days", "lost keys" and "rosetta stoned". tbh, i didn't know what to make of it....so i just kinda thought i'd share it.
